**Position overview**:
The Senior Total Rewards Analyst will be responsible for supporting compensation strategies through data-driven insights and analysis. This role focuses on all aspects of data analytics support for the Compensation Team, including survey participation, market pricing, pay benchmarking, pay equity analysis, scenario modelling and equity compensation support. This role will work collaboratively with Total Rewards Consultants and external partners to ensure competitive and equitable compensation practices aligned with the company’s Total Rewards strategy.
**Key responsibilities include**:
- Conducting market pricing of jobs using survey data (e.g., Radford, Mercer) to determine appropriate compensation ranges
- Maintaining and updating job architecture and compensation structures across functions and geographies
- Participating in compensation surveys and ensure accurate, timely data submissions
- Partnering with Total Rewards Consultants to understand market trends, hiring challenges, and talent pressures across regions
- Leveraging external intelligence and benchmarking data to develop initial recommendations for market movement and pay structures
- Supporting the planning and execution of the annual base pay review cycle, including data preparation, reporting, and post-cycle analysis
- Assisting with calibration of recommendations, guideline alignment, and integration of performance outcomes
- Conducting internal pay equity (fairness) reviews and support remediation efforts where necessary
- Supporting preparation for EU Pay Transparency
- Analyzing compensation data to identify trends, risks, and opportunities across employee groups
- Supporting annual compensation cycles (base pay, bonus, equity) with data audits and reports
**What are we looking for?**
-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Finance, Business, Economics, or a related field required
- Job related experience in compensation, rewards, or HR analytics for 2-4 years
- Advenced knowledge of Excel (pivot tables, VLOOKUP, formulas) and familiarity with HRIS and compensation tools (e.g., SuccessFactors, WTW CompSource, Mercer WIN)
- Strong analytical and modelling capabilities including ability to interpret analysis/data and knowledge of data modelling tools (eg PowerBi) preferred
- Fluent English
